LIP FILLER
Fillers, also known as dermal fillers, are used to replace lost volume. As we age, our cells produce less natural collagen and elastin and our skin becomes drier and less plump due to a reduction in the naturally occurring hyaluronic acid in our bodies. (HA is a sugar molecule that is present throughout the body and lubricates joints and acts as a moisturising cushion.)
Dermal fillers, which are high in HA, are injected under the skin through a fine needle, this adds volume, visibly smoothing lines and wrinkles and making the face fresher. Generally, fillers would be used in the cheek area or the lips to plump out the outline and restore volume.
Lip Filler -
As part of the ageing process, lips can lose their natural elasticity causing them to become thinner, lose their shape and decrease in volume. Lip fillers are a quick, effective and non-invasive solution to help you regain natural, shapely and fuller lips.
We offer standard Lip Fillers and Russian Lip Fillers. Standard lip filler is more rounded from the side and the Russian technique is flat.
Russian Lip Filler -
Is the most popular lip filling technique of 2020. It controls both the shape and volume of the lip keeping them flat. It gives you a natural look with an accentuated Cupid’s bow for doll-like lips. This technique is suitable for any age. We can customise the technique to suit your individual taste.
I personally love normal lip fillers, Russian Lips give your lips extra shape and volume whilst remaining flat. Perfect for those who desire a fuller look. This technique takes slightly longer than the standard due to the careful positioning of the filler and is prone to more bruising and swelling, you must take this into consideration.

BENEFITS OF LIP FILLER
You must understand that the injecting technique, causes an inflammatory response, such a swelling and bruising. This can cause disappointment over the following weeks, as the swelling subsides.
Your lips may appear smaller once the swelling goes down, the filler has NOT dissolved or disappeared, you have not wasted your money. You need to be patient. The product has sunken and formed a layer, at the base of your lip.
Most clients find that they need 2 or 3 layers before the filler builds up and no longer has room to sink, leaving you with a fuller look.
Once the filler has been built up, you should only need to replace the top layer, every 6-12 months as the bottom layer slowly dissolves.
A safe way is to layer your lips every 2 months over 3 sessions. Then you can visit once every 6-12 months.

Frequently asked questions
Are these injections painful?
A pre numb is used 10mins before the treatment, to help with any dicomfort.
How long do they last?
Every client is different, some clients get an immediate result and others may take two or three sessions. The same with how log they will last, it is really down to each client.
How safe is Dermal Filler? Are there any side effects?
Fillers now are mainly hyaluronic acid, which is dissolvable and metabolised by the body. The fillers used 10 or 20 years ago were silicone and that was a problem because they were permanent.
How long is recovery?
Please allow up to 14 days for swelling or brusing to go down.
What is Lip Filler?
Filler is made of Hyaluronic Acid. It works like a sponge and fills up with water upon injecting, filling out fine line, wrinkles and plumping lips.
Will there be swelling?
You may experience redness, bruising or swelling in the injected area. This should not last longer than 2 weeks. Light makeup can be applied 24 hours after treatment.
Can it be dissolved if i do not like it?
Filler can be dissolved most of the time by the use of Hyaluronidase, via small injetions to break down the product.
Can i fly after treatment?
We advise you wait at least 48 hours before flying.
Is there an age limit for treatment?
You must be over 18 years old, if you look younger please bring i.d with you as you will be asked for it.
How long does the treatment take?
Roughly 20 - 30 mins on average.
How quickly will i see results?
You should start seeing your true results about a week after treatment, once any swelling or bruising fades.
